您当前的位置:首页 > 常见问答

数据库三级应用题解读及参考资料

作者:远客网络

在解答数据库三级应用题时,需要注意以下几点:

  1. 题目要求的数据库操作:仔细阅读题目,理解题目要求的数据库操作,例如查询、插入、更新、删除等。确保清楚题目的要求,以便正确地进行后续操作。

  2. 数据库表结构分析:对于给定的数据库表结构,仔细分析各个表之间的关系,包括主键、外键等。了解表之间的关联关系,有助于更好地理解题目要求和正确地设计查询语句。

  3. 使用SQL语句解题:根据题目要求,使用SQL语句进行查询、插入、更新、删除等操作。熟练掌握SQL语句的语法和常用函数,灵活运用各种查询条件和连接操作符。

  4. 数据库索引的优化:在解答题目时,可以考虑使用合适的索引来优化查询性能。分析查询语句的执行计划,查看是否需要创建索引或者对已有索引进行调整,以提高查询效率。

  5. 数据库事务处理:在解答题目时,需要注意数据库事务的处理。对于需要进行多个操作的题目,要保证数据的一致性和完整性,可以使用事务来确保一组操作的原子性。

通过以上几点的注意,可以更好地解答数据库三级应用题,提高解题的准确性和效率。同时,还可以通过练习和实践来提升对数据库的理解和应用能力。

在数据库三级应用题中,我们需要关注以下几个方面:

  1. 数据库设计:这是一个数据库应用的基础,需要根据需求设计数据库的表结构、字段和关系。在设计过程中,需要考虑数据的完整性、一致性和有效性。

  2. SQL语句:数据库应用离不开SQL语言,通过SQL语句可以实现数据的增删改查操作。在解答应用题时,需要根据题目要求编写相应的SQL语句,包括创建表、插入数据、更新数据和查询数据等。

  3. 数据库查询优化:在应用题中,可能会涉及到复杂的查询操作,需要考虑如何优化查询语句,提高查询性能。可以通过索引、分区、优化器提示等技术手段来实现。

  4. 事务处理:数据库应用中常常需要处理事务,保证数据的一致性和完整性。在应用题中,可能会要求编写涉及事务处理的SQL语句,需要了解事务的特性和处理方式。

  5. 数据库安全性:数据库应用中的数据可能涉及到敏感信息,需要保证数据的安全性。在解答应用题时,需要考虑如何防止SQL注入、数据泄露和未授权访问等安全问题。

在解答数据库三级应用题时,需要掌握数据库设计、SQL语句编写、查询优化、事务处理和数据库安全等知识,灵活运用这些知识来解决问题。

数据库三级应用题主要看以下几个方面:

  1. 数据库设计能力:对于给定的需求,能够合理地设计数据库结构,包括表的设计、字段的定义、主键、外键等的设置。在设计数据库时,需要考虑数据的完整性、一致性和性能等方面的问题。

  2. 数据库操作能力:能够熟练地使用SQL语言进行数据库的增删改查操作,包括表的创建、数据的插入、更新和删除,以及查询语句的编写和优化。同时,还需要了解数据库的事务处理和并发控制机制,保证数据的一致性和并发安全性。

  3. 数据库性能优化能力:能够通过对查询语句的优化和索引的设计来提高数据库的查询性能。熟悉数据库的执行计划和索引原理,能够根据具体的场景进行性能调优,提高数据库的响应速度和吞吐量。

  4. 数据库备份与恢复能力:了解数据库的备份与恢复策略,能够选择合适的备份方式,并能够进行数据的备份和恢复操作。还需要了解数据库的容灾和高可用技术,保证数据的安全性和可用性。

  5. 数据库安全能力:了解数据库的权限管理机制,能够进行用户和角色的管理,并设置合适的权限,保护数据库的安全。同时,还需要了解数据库的加密和脱敏技术,保护敏感数据的安全。

在解决数据库三级应用题时,需要综合运用上述能力,根据具体的需求进行数据库的设计和操作,同时考虑性能、安全和可用性等方面的要求。